Current Landscape of Cosmetic Manufacturing in Gambia

Analyzing the intersection of tropical climate challenges and evolving skincare demands in the West African region.

The Gambian cosmetic market is currently characterized by a high demand for products that can withstand extreme humidity and heat. Local consumers are increasingly seeking a professional Face Wash that removes urban pollutants without stripping the skin of essential moisture, a common issue in the coastal regions of Banjul.

There is a significant shift toward "dermaceuticals." The popularity of benchmarks like the Cerave Facial Cleanser has educated the local market on the importance of ceramides and skin barrier protection, pushing local manufacturers to move beyond basic soaps toward scientifically formulated cleansers.

Moreover, the prevalence of hyperpigmentation due to intense UV exposure has made brightening agents essential. This has led to a surge in demand for the Turmeric Face Mask, blending traditional African botanical knowledge with modern chemical stability to ensure safe and effective brightening.

Market Development History

Prior to 2010, the Gambian market relied heavily on traditional oils and imported basic soaps. The formulation technology was rudimentary, focusing primarily on cleansing rather than targeted treatment.

Between 2010 and 2020, the "Active Ingredient Era" began. Manufacturers started incorporating stabilized vitamins and acids, introducing products like Anti-aging face cream to address the needs of an aging urban population and the effects of photo-aging.

Since 2021, the market has entered the "Barrier-First Era," where the focus has shifted to microbiome health and pH-balanced chemistry, ensuring that active ingredients do not cause irritation in sensitive, heat-stressed skin.

How to ensure a Vitamin C serum stays stable in Gambia's heat?

We use advanced encapsulation and airless packaging technology to prevent oxidation, ensuring the serum remains potent despite high ambient temperatures.

Can you formulate a face wash specifically for oily skin in tropical climates?

Yes, we create sebum-regulating formulas that use mild surfactants to cleanse deeply without triggering compensatory oil production.

What is the best way to incorporate turmeric into a commercial face mask?

We utilize standardized turmeric extracts to ensure color consistency and use emulsifiers that prevent the mask from staining the skin.

Is it possible to create an anti-aging cream that isn't greasy in humidity?

Absolutely. We utilize "water-drop" technology and lightweight polymers to provide hydration without a heavy, occlusive feel.

How does your cleanser compare to a Cerave facial cleanser in terms of barrier repair?

Our formulas integrate a similar ceramide complex and hyaluronic acid to ensure the skin barrier remains intact during the cleansing process.
